Senior Software Engineer / Solutions Architect
Jobgether • USThis position is posted by Jobgether on behalf of a partner company. We are currently looking for a Senior Software Engineer / Solutions Architect in United States.
This role offers the chance to lead the design and development of production-grade AI solutions, including LLM-based applications, RAG systems, and agentic workflows, across diverse client environments. You will own technical strategy, architecture decisions, and end-to-end solution delivery while mentoring engineers and collaborating with cross-functional teams. The ideal candidate thrives in fast-paced, client-facing settings, applies deep Python and cloud expertise, and embeds AI across the development lifecycle. You will influence both technical direction and business outcomes, balancing innovation with pragmatic, production-ready implementation. This position emphasizes autonomy, proactive problem-solving, and direct engagement with global clients on AI-driven solutions.
Accountabilities:
- Design, implement, and maintain production-grade Python services, RESTful APIs, and AI-integrated backend systems
- Build and optimize RAG systems, LLM-based applications, and agentic AI workflows to solve real-world client problems
- Lead architecture decisions, produce technical design documents, and set standards across the Python practice
- Own technical strategy from discovery through delivery, supporting presales activities including demos, proposals, and scoping
- Mentor engineers, lead code reviews, and disseminate knowledge across teams
- Build and maintain trusted relationships with client stakeholders, serving as a technical advisor and point of contact
- 7+ years of experience building and running production systems, with strong Python proficiency (OOP, design patterns, clean architecture)
- Hands-on experience with AI/ML integration, LLM APIs (OpenAI, Anthropic, AWS Bedrock), and agentic workflows
- Experience designing and maintaining RESTful APIs with FastAPI, Django REST, or Flask
- Expertise in architecture trade-offs, microservices, cloud infrastructure (AWS or GCP), and cost optimization
- Strong testing practices, including pytest, mocking, and integration testing for AI systems
- Experience with Docker, Kubernetes, and CI/CD pipelines (GitHub Actions, GitLab CI)
- Full-stack mindset with knowledge of frontend frameworks (React, Vue) considered a plus
- Excellent communication skills and B2+ English for collaboration across distributed, multicultural teams
- Preferred: experience with Streamlit/Gradio, modern Python tooling (ruff, pyproject.toml, pyright), additional languages (Go, Node.js, Rust), and AWS/Claude Code certifications
- Work on cutting-edge AI and cloud solutions with high-impact client projects
- Internal training programs with full support for professional certifications
- Clear career growth path toward Solutions Architect and leadership roles
- Access to the latest AI tools and premium subscriptions
- Fully remote with flexible hours and unlimited vacation policy
- Comprehensive health, vision, and dental insurance
- 401(k) matching plan
Requirements:
Benefits: